EXCEEDS logo
Exceeds
Ageev Maxim

PROFILE

Ageev Maxim

Maksim worked on enhancing error handling and documentation across the facebookincubator/cinder and python/mypy repositories. He improved bytes formatting in Cinder by refining type-checking logic and introducing targeted error messages for the 'i' flag, using C and Python to ensure that invalid input types raise precise exceptions. Maksim also developed comprehensive unit tests and a PseudoFloat class to simulate non-integer types, further strengthening robustness. In Mypy, he reorganized documentation written in reStructuredText to clarify usage of future annotations, making onboarding and maintenance easier. His work demonstrated careful attention to maintainability, reliability, and clear communication through both code and documentation.

Overall Statistics

Feature vs Bugs

33%Features

Repository Contributions

3Total
Bugs
2
Commits
3
Features
1
Lines of code
46
Activity Months2

Work History

April 2025

2 Commits • 1 Features

Apr 1, 2025

April 2025 monthly performance summary focusing on robustness, reliability, and developer experience across two repositories. Key work delivered strengthens type-checking and error reporting in formatting operations, while also improving documentation clarity to support faster onboarding and maintenance. The efforts reduce risk of misreported errors and make future changes safer and easier to document.

March 2025

1 Commits

Mar 1, 2025

March 2025 monthly summary for facebookincubator/cinder focusing on a targeted bug fix that significantly improves bytes formatting error handling with the 'i' flag, and demonstrates disciplined debugging and maintainability work.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

CPythonrst

Technical Skills

C programmingDocumentationPython developmentPython programmingerror handlingunit testing

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

facebookincubator/cinder

Mar 2025 Apr 2025
2 Months active

Languages Used

CPython

Technical Skills

C programmingPython developmentunit testingPython programmingerror handling

python/mypy

Apr 2025 Apr 2025
1 Month active

Languages Used

rst

Technical Skills

Documentation